Yogi Berra, the great Yankees catcher and manager, had a unique way of saying things. Over the years, I've found that some of Yogi Berra's quotes apply to plant breeders and to plant breeding. Dr. Rex Bernardo is professor and endowed chair in maize breeding and genetics at the University of Minnesota. He obtained his undergraduate degree in the Philippines in 1984 and his Ph.D. degree in plant breeding from the University of Illinois in 1988. Dr. Bernardo developed the widely used GBLUP procedure in 1994, and most of his work has focused on marker-assisted breeding. Dr. Bernardo is director of the Plant Breeding Center at Minnesota, has written two textbooks, and teaches graduate courses in plant breeding and in professional skills for scientists."
